Dunzo was an Indian hyperlocal delivery and quick-commerce platform founded in July 2014 in Bengaluru by Kabeer Biswas, Ankur Agarwal, Dalvir Suri and Mukund Jha, which grew from a WhatsApp group into an app-based service delivering groceries, food, medicines, pet supplies and same-city packages across up to nine Indian cities. Its Dunzo for Business (D4B) offering gave merchants last-mile delivery through a partner API and through multi-carrier aggregators. Backed by Google, Blume Ventures, Alteria Capital and Reliance Retail, the company was dissolved on 14 January 2025; the app and website were shut down and every Dunzo-operated host, including its merchant API, is now offline. This profile is retained as a historical record — Dunzo publishes no developer portal, documentation, specification or support channel today.
